FAQs

  1. Is souping diet a good way to lose weight?

Yes, the souping diet can be an effective way to lose weight, as the soups are usually low in calories and high in fiber, helping you feel fuller for longer periods.

  1. Can I include non-vegetable-based soups in my souping diet?

It is best to stick to vegetable-based soups when following the souping diet, as they are typically lower in calories and higher in nutrients than non-vegetable-based soups.

  1. Can I have snacks while following the souping diet?

Yes, snacks can be incorporated into your souping diet, but it is best to choose healthy options such as fruits, vegetables, or a small portion of nuts.

  1. How long should I follow the souping diet?

The souping diet can be followed for a few days to a few weeks, depending on your goals and overall health. However, it is essential to listen to your body’s needs and cons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new diet regimen.

  1. Is the souping diet suitable for everyone?

The souping diet may not be suitable for everyone, particularly those who require a higher protein intake, such as athletes or bodybuilders. It is important to cons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new diet regimen.
